Output 143cd93655da0ef97275833b17871b30dcf55d9ae35596b22f6002eda533bc67:1

value
4907467
script pubkey
OP_0 OP_PUSHBYTES_20 84018b45f4253874f748897a2a9505304fac085b
address
bc1qssqck305y5u8fa6g39az49g9xp86czzmw65r6f
transaction
143cd93655da0ef97275833b17871b30dcf55d9ae35596b22f6002eda533bc67
confirmations
150900
spent
true